    Interesting fact about Case Closed/Detective Conan - Around the 900th episode they made it clear that only 6 months have gone by since he became a child. He has solved WELL over 300 Murder Cases mostly in the major cities in 6 months- which is more than the yearly average in all of Japan. On top of that they went from not having cell phones, to having big cell phones, to having flip phones, to having smart phones- in 6 months! I guess that happens when you have been making a series for over 20 years! Oh also if you do that math things continue to get weird seeing as he must be solving 5 of these crimes every day- but some crimes take place over multiple days or even weeks- And people think 10 year old Ash is crazy...

    I want to add to the Cased Closed talk. I've been watching since high school, so about 2004, gawd I think I just broke a hip typing that, and there's three things I feel you need to know/accept in order to enjoy the show, iffin you intend on enjoying it.
    So thing one, as mentioned in the video, the show doesn't have much in the way of resolution. It started in 1986 or so and is still going strong today. That's not to say that it's all dilly dallying but well there are long stretches of filler, usually you can tell by the quality of the mystery, looking at you bee episode. If you love mysteries it's still a fun ride and if you don't love mysteries maybe just watch the movies, which are the show turned up to 11.
    Second thing, as mentioned it started in 86, and it's set in present day. We're now in 2020 and it's still set in present day. It's not always the best at handling that. A good example is that early on Shinichi's inventor friend/neighbor, it was the 80s everyone had one, invents badges so he and his kid friends can communicate, but now they all just have cell phones. Things like that.
    And thirdly if you do decide to binge it. You will developed something called detective brain. You'll see mysteries everywhere and will instinctively try and solve them. During this period it's best to keep it all to yourself. You will sound crazy, trust me.
    Cased closed is great but it is still going so, don't just buckle up, hunker down. Because it will outlive us all.

    It's an obvious one, but I'll always recommend Ghost in the Shell: Stand Alone Complex, 2nd GIG and Solid State Society, an exquisite cyberpunk thriller that balances both philosophical questions about the nature of humanity, just like the classic, seminal manga it's roughly based on, well-directed, quick action and plots ranging from human trafficking to a series of apparently unrelated terrorist attacks in a post-World War III and IV Japan that sprung back up from the ashes of the war as one of the world's major powers thanks to *NANOMACHINES, SON* .
    For something a little less known and especially if fantasy and JRPGs are your thing, Magical Circle Guru Guru is the series for you. With a first season of 45 episodes produced in the mid-90s, a 38-episode second season produced in the early 2000s and a 2017 24-episode remake by Production I.G, the story follows the gentle-hearted, naive little mage girl Kukuri, the last of the Migu Migu tribe who can use the Guru Guru magic, and the "Hero of the Legend" Nike, raised by his parents with the hope that he'd become a world-renowned and famous hero due to having his father's dreams pushed onto him, given that no great evil arose during his father's youth. Together, their mission is to defeat the evil Lord Giri, who was freed from the magic that sealed him for 300 years, and can only be defeated by Guru Guru magic. The series as a whole is both a love letter and a parody of the JRPGs of the 80s and 90s, particularly Dragon Quest, developed by the actual publishers of the series, Enix (yes, Square Enix is the owner of Gangan Comics, which published Fullmetal Alchemist and Soul Eater, too), and while it does rely on toilet jokes once or twice, it's an absurd and hilarious journey with literal side quests and RPG mechanics baked into both the story and the world's inner logic, almost as if the characters are aware of being inside a JRPG.
    If you're into sports, instead, I fondly suggest yet another gem from the past, Mitsuru Adachi's magnum opus Touch, a whopping 101-episode story that follows twin brothers Tatsuya and Kazuya Uesugi and their shared love interest, next-door girl Minami Asakura. Due to a childhood promise to her, Kazuya decides, once enrolled in Meisei High School, that he's gonna put his whole being into baseball so that he can become the team's ace pitcher and bring them to the Koshien, Japan's national high school baseball tournament, named after the Hanshin Koshien Stadium in Nishinomiya, home to the Hanshin Tigers. It's a beautifully woven story of sports, love, personal growth and drama which will bring you to both exciting peaks of hype and depths of sadness and desperation - because, spoilers, and I do mean it, SPOILERS, the morning of the final game of the prefectural tournament of their first year, Kazuya is struck by a truck in a traffic accident, losing his life while saving a kid, leaving his twin brother Tatsuya and the baseball team utterly emotionally destroyed, and so Tatsuya takes his deceased brother's mantle in order to fulfill his dream and his promise to their friend.
    Much shorter (and sadly with a bit of fluff in the middle), but also the only non-manga based anime in this list is The Secret of Blue Water, the first anime ever produced by Gainax, directed by Hideaki Anno and based on a concept pitched by Hayao Miyazaki to NHK in the 1970s, it's a fascinating steampunk adventure set in 1889 and following the adventure of titular Nadia (as the original title of the series, "Fushigi no Umi no Nadia", "Nadia of the Mysterious Seas", features her front and center much like the story), a 14-year-old circus acrobat of unknown origins and Jean, a young French inventor of the same age as they run from thieves Grandis, Sanson and Hanson, who are after Nadia's *actually* titular pendant, the Blue Water, tied to her mysterious past.
